Example #1
0
    def Args(parser):
        Update.CommonArgs(parser)

        # Flags specific to managed CR
        managed_group = flags.GetManagedArgGroup(parser)
        flags.AddVpcConnectorArg(managed_group)

        # Flags not specific to any platform
        flags.AddMinInstancesFlag(parser)
        flags.AddServiceAccountFlagAlpha(parser)
Example #2
0
    def Args(parser):
        Deploy.CommonArgs(parser)

        # Flags specific to connecting to a cluster
        cluster_group = flags.GetClusterArgGroup(parser)
        flags.AddSecretsFlags(cluster_group)
        flags.AddConfigMapsFlags(cluster_group)
        flags.AddHttp2Flag(cluster_group)

        # Flags not specific to any platform
        flags.AddMinInstancesFlag(parser)
        flags.AddNoTrafficFlag(parser)
        flags.AddServiceAccountFlagAlpha(parser)
Example #3
0
    def Args(parser):
        Update.CommonArgs(parser)

        # Flags specific to managed CR
        managed_group = flags.GetManagedArgGroup(parser)
        flags.AddVpcConnectorArg(managed_group)

        # Flags specific to connecting to a cluster
        cluster_group = flags.GetClusterArgGroup(parser)
        flags.AddSecretsFlags(cluster_group)
        flags.AddConfigMapsFlags(cluster_group)
        flags.AddHttp2Flag(cluster_group)

        # Flags not specific to any platform
        flags.AddMinInstancesFlag(parser)
        flags.AddServiceAccountFlagAlpha(parser)
Example #4
0
  def Args(parser):
    Deploy.CommonArgs(parser)

    # Flags not specific to any platform
    flags.AddMinInstancesFlag(parser)
    flags.AddNoTrafficFlag(parser)
    flags.AddServiceAccountFlagAlpha(parser)

    # Flags inherited from gcloud builds submit
    flags.AddConfigFlags(parser)
    flags.AddSourceFlag(parser)
    flags.AddBuildTimeoutFlag(parser)
    build_flags.AddGcsSourceStagingDirFlag(parser, True)
    build_flags.AddGcsLogDirFlag(parser, True)
    build_flags.AddMachineTypeFlag(parser, True)
    build_flags.AddDiskSizeFlag(parser, True)
    build_flags.AddSubstitutionsFlag(parser, True)
    build_flags.AddNoCacheFlag(parser, True)
    build_flags.AddIgnoreFileFlag(parser, True)